An Accelerated Program is a program leading to a recognized credential that is offered in half or less than half the time over which it may normally be offered, as measured by the number of program weeks. A program must be designated by Advanced Education as an Accelerated Program. What does an accelerated program mean? […]

Do All Unions In Canada Belong To The Canadian Labour Congress?
Most local unions are affiliated to the Canadian Labour Congress. However, there are a number of unions that discourage their locals from affiliating for a variety or reasons. Who regulates unions in Canada? Unions in Canada are regulated by federal and provincial legislation. They are required by law to be democratic and financially accountable to […]
